摘要
在对具有预制式轨道板的无蹅轨道分析的基础上,针对预制式轨道板结构的特点,建立了预制式轨道板结构的力学模型(即刚体模型).通过对预制式轨道板不同纵向布置对轨道和桥梁系统振动响应影响的分析,得到了无蹅轨道中预制式轨道板的合理布置方式.
A dynamic model for the prefabricated floating slabs was presented on the basis of analysis of a floating slab track system.In the model,the floating slabs are regarded as rigid bodys supported by elastomer bearings.By exploring the effect of the layout of floating slabs on the train-bridge coupled vibration characteristics,a reasonable layout configuration of floating slabs on the floating slab track system was obtained.
